Comprehending Italy's Pharmacy System
In Italy, medications are strictly managed to ensure patient safety. Pharmacies, locally called Farmacie, are easily recognizable by their radiant green crosses. Italian pharmacists are extremely trained health care specialists who can use important guidance for minor conditions, but knowing the classification of medications is vital before attempting to buy them.

How do I discover an open drug store at night or on Sunday?
Every Italian town has a lineup published on the shutter of every local drug store detailing which Farmacia di Turno (on-duty drug store) is open overnight or on weekends. You can also search online using mapping services for "farmacia di turno" followed by your city name.
Can EU citizens use their EHIC card to get totally free pain relievers?
The European Health Insurance Card (EHIC) grants access to medically required, state-provided health care throughout a short-lived remain in Italy. However, it usually does not cover the full cost of standard over the counter drug store purchases unless recommended by a public sector physician for intense health center or clinic care.
